You have to load them in the axe-fx, how else would the axe-fx process them. But for auditioning you can just use the scratchpad slot. It is very fast.
You can load up to 8 IRs, besides mixing you can solo or mute any combination of the IRs. So you can quickly A/B 8 separate IRs, or 2 combinations of 4 IRs, or 4 combinations of 2 IRs, etc.
Just solo the IRs you want want to combine and hit send. solo another set and hit send and it will load.

think of the Scratchpad slot as a temporary slot. you're over complicating things here. you have your Axe, connected via USB, you have Cab-Lab connected to the Axe. just like Fractal Bot, you can send a Mix straight to the Axe's Scratchpad to audition the mix. which way you're listening to your Axe is up to you...headphones, frfr... since that Mix is "live" at this stage (and not "printed") you'll have to export it as a new IR if you like it and then load it into any user slot in the Axe...
